Alaska Behavioral Health is seeking a Client Access Coordinator (Reception) in Fairbanks to support clinical teams by handling calls, scheduling appointments, and managing client information. This full-time role requires strong communication, reliability, and the ability to work in a fast-paced setting.
You will assist with day-to-day clinic operations, check-in/check-out processes, and coordinating needs across staff.

The Client Access Team plays a vital role in ensuring quality customer service is provided in a professional and efficient manner. They facilitate the care of both internal and external AKBH consumers by providing administrative assistance to Clinical Teams, Medical Providers, Program, and Administrative Staff. AKBH Client Access Coordinators are known for their welcoming, positive demeanor and their ability to work effectively with diverse members of the community, including stakeholders and individuals with behavioral or physical limitations or disabilities.
